Discovery is a Publicis Health company that is focused on identifying and implementing key collaborative advocacy strategies for bio-pharmaceutical companies. We believe in helping the industry live its visions of improving the lives of the patients and communities they serve in ways that go beyond product development and delivery. Entire communities can benefit from initiatives that raise awareness, expand access, address disparities, and support improved standards of care. The Discovery advocacy team has been at the forefront of development in the healthcare advocacy field for more than 20 years, working with clients to develop internal advocacy structure as well as collaborative initiatives in education, awareness, access, policy, and other key areas. We think beyond traditional parameters and develop innovative solutions to stay ahead of the evolving political, regulatory, legislative, medical, and economic environments.

The Project Manager is responsible for supporting project execution and advocacy client/stakeholder relationships, basic landscape monitoring and research, and executing administrative tasks for internal and external processes—including routing materials through the agency, processing invoices, operations support, and data entry. The ideal candidate will be adept at providing operational and coordination support in a fast paced and ambiguous environment.

Our benefits package includes medical coverage, dental, vision, disability, 401K, as well as parental and family care leave, family forming assistance, tuition reimbursement, and flexible time off.
Compensation Range: $59,850 - $82,740 annually. This is the pay range the Company believes it will pay for this position at the time of this posting. Consistent with applicable law, compensation will be determined based on the skills, qualifications, and experience of the applicant along with the requirements of the position, and the Company reserves the right to modify this pay range at any time.
